Mountain biking around Saint-Auban-D'Oze, located in the Hautes-Alpes department of Provence-Alpes-Côte d'Azur, offers diverse landscapes and varied terrain. The region features a mix of wild valleys, mid-mountains, and vast prairies, providing a range of experiences for mountain bikers. Trails navigate through areas like the Dévoluy massif and incorporate features such as the Clue de Saint-Auban gorge, making it a destination for varied mountain bike trails.

The view of Aujour (Montagne de l’Aujour) is one of the most spectacular panoramas in the area between the Alpes-de-Haute-Provence and the Sisteron area: a long limestone ridge that dominates valleys, hills and, on clear days, opens up to the Prealps and the Durance basin.

Located in the Upper Valley of Maraize, the Abbey of Clausonne was built in 1185 as a monastic place and refuge for the population. Burned down during the Wars of Religion in 1573 and then again by Sardinian troops in 1692, the remains were used for agriculture and finally collapsed after World War II.

There are over 75 mountain bike trails around Saint-Auban-D'Oze, offering a wide range of experiences from easy rides to challenging ascents. The region's diverse landscapes, including wild valleys, mid-mountains, and vast prairies, provide varied terrain for all skill levels.
The best time for mountain biking in Saint-Auban-D'Oze is generally from spring through autumn. During these seasons, the weather is most favorable, and the trails are typically dry and accessible. The Southern French Alps offer pleasant conditions for exploring the diverse landscapes.
Yes, Saint-Auban-D'Oze offers 6 easy mountain bike trails, perfect for beginners or families looking for a more relaxed ride. These routes often feature gentler gradients and less technical terrain. An example is the View of L'Aujour – The Shores of the Lake loop from Oze, which is 12.1 miles long and leads through the scenic Oze valley.
You can expect a diverse range of terrain, from forest climbs and routes with beautiful views to technical sections that may require pushing your bike. The region features wild valleys, mid-mountains, and vast prairies, with access to the Dévoluy massif and notable geological features like the Clue de Saint-Auban gorge.
Absolutely. Saint-Auban-D'Oze has 34 difficult mountain bike routes designed for experienced riders seeking significant climbs and technical challenges. For instance, the Guérins Pass – Pessier Lake loop from Le Saix is a demanding 45.4-mile route with over 1700 meters of elevation gain.
The region is rich in natural beauty. You can encounter stunning features like the Espréaux Pass, offering spectacular views of the Southern Alps. The Shores of the Lake provide picturesque scenery, and the area also offers access to the dramatic Clue de Saint-Auban gorge and views of the Montagne d'Oule.
Yes, many mountain bike routes around Saint-Auban-D'Oze are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. Examples include the Source loop from Veynes, a moderate 18.2-mile trail, and the more challenging Clausonne Abbey – Pessier Lake loop from Le Saix.

Yes, the region features several mountain passes that offer rewarding climbs and stunning views. Notable passes include the Espréaux Pass and the Faye Pass. These passes often form part of longer, more challenging routes.
Yes, some routes incorporate beautiful water features. For example, the Pessier Lake – Abbaye de Clausonne loop from Le Saix offers views of Pessier Lake. Additionally, the larger Lake Serre-Ponçon is approximately 40 km away, providing another significant natural attraction in the broader region.
Many routes in Saint-Auban-D'Oze provide excellent panoramic views. The region offers access to the Dévoluy massif, and climbs towards points like the Montagne d'Oule are known for formidable vistas of the Dévoluy, Montagne de Céüse, and Baronnies. The Espréaux Pass is also noted for its spectacular views of the Southern Alps.
